The Intrusion Detection and Prevention Systems (IDPS) market is witnessing a significant transformation fueled by technological advancements, increasing cyber threats, and a fundamental shift in how organizations perceive and implement cybersecurity strategies. With the global market projected to reach USD 20 billion by 2034, the growth trajectory indicates a robust CAGR. Key factors driving this expansion include the integration of artificial intelligence into security measures, heightened digital transformations, and the increased frequency and complexity of cyberattacks that necessitate advanced protection solutions.

The Role of Artificial Intelligence
Artificial intelligence has emerged as a cornerstone of innovation within the IDPS market, revolutionizing the way intrusions are detected and managed. AI-enabled IDPS systems not only enhance threat recognition capabilities but also mitigate false alarms, ensuring that alerts are accurate and actionable. By employing machine learning algorithms, these systems learn and adapt to new threats, constantly improving their ability to detect anomalies that deviate from normal patterns. This adaptability is crucial in a landscape where cyber threats are continuously evolving, presenting a moving target for traditional security measures.
AI enhances IDPS systems by enabling automated responses to potential threats, significantly reducing response times and ensuring that breaches are addressed promptly. The effectiveness of AI in these systems is prompting rapid adoption across various sectors, particularly in industries where data security is paramount. As a result, organizations are experiencing increased operational efficiency, lower costs associated with manual monitoring, and improved overall security postures. This technology-driven change is propelling the IDPS market forward, establishing AI as an indispensable component of modern cybersecurity strategies.

Comprehensive Security Models
The introduction of comprehensive security models, such as the zero-trust architecture, has generated significant interest and adoption within the IDPS market. The zero-trust approach advocates for rigorous verification and authentication at every stage of system access, ensuring that no user or device is trusted by default. This security paradigm aligns well with the capabilities of modern IDPS solutions, which leverage advanced technologies to facilitate stringent network security.
Zero-trust models are growing in popularity, especially in sectors that handle sensitive data such as finance, healthcare, and government services. These industries are witnessing the effectiveness of adopting multi-layered security frameworks integrated with AI-enhanced IDPS to mitigate cyber risks. By harmonizing traditional security systems with contemporary zero-trust models, organizations can adopt a holistic approach to network security, providing comprehensive protection against the growing specter of sophisticated cyber threats. This paradigm shift toward zero trust represents an important evolution in the way cybersecurity solutions are conceptualized and implemented, reinforcing the IDPS market’s trajectory toward innovative, inclusive security solutions that prioritize trustworthiness and resilience.
